Motorcycle Rider Dies in High Speed Crash in Downtown Salem

(SALEM, Ore.) - Salem Police say excessive speed appears to be a factor in the death of a Washington motorcyclist who died Saturday night in downtown Salem.

Investigators say it appears that 19-year old Bragin Mikhail Jr. of Washougal, Washington died on impact just before 11:00 PM.

Lengthy skid marks attest to the rider’s apparent attempt to regain control as he was eastbound on Trade Street, Salem Police say, but the bike left the road just before reaching Church Street.

Mr. Mikhail was thrown from the bike and his body impacted a six-inch square metal pole. Police say the motorcycle continued on for another 80 to 100 feet from where Mr. Mikhail was located.

Police aren’t sure exactly how much time passed before a motorist observed the crash scene and approached the rider. The 911 center was notified by the driver who stated at that point that the cyclist was clearly deceased.

If anyone witnessed this crash, they are asked to call the Salem Police Traffic Unit.
